Derleme zamanı adresi bağlaması nedir?
Derleme zamanı adresi bağlaması nedir?

Video: Derleme zamanı adresi bağlaması nedir?

Video: Derleme zamanı adresi bağlaması nedir?
Video: Patron görmesin :) 2024, Kasım
Anonim

İlk tür adres bağlama NS derleme zamanı adres bağlama . Bu, program yürütülebilir bir ikili dosyaya derlendiğinde, bir bilgisayarın makine koduna bellekte bir yer ayırır. NS adres bağlama alojik tahsis eder adres nesne kodunun depolandığı bellekteki segmentin başlangıç noktasına.

Basitçe, derleme zamanı bağlayıcı nedir?

NS derleyici adı verilen bir işlemi gerçekleştirir bağlayıcı bir nesne bir nesne değişkenine atandığında. bağlayıcı ( statik bağlama ) atıfta bulunur derleme zamanı bağlama ve geç bağlayıcı (dinamik bağlayıcı ) çalışma zamanını ifade eder bağlayıcı.

Ayrıca bilin, derleme zamanı ne anlama geliyor? derlemek - zaman Çalıştırma sırasında girdiğiniz kodun yürütülebilir dosyaya dönüştürüldüğü örnektir. zaman yürütülebilir dosyanın çalıştığı örnektir. "Çalışma zamanı" ve " Derleme zamanı " genellikle programcılar tarafından farklı hata türlerine atıfta bulunmak için kullanılır. derlemek - zaman sırasında kontrol gerçekleşir Derleme zamanı.

Ayrıca bilmek, adres bağlama ile ne kastedilmektedir?

Adres bağlama programın mantıksal veya sanal adresler karşılık gelen fiziksel veya ana belleğe adresler . Başka bir deyişle, belirli bir mantıksal adres MMU (Bellek Yönetim Birimi) tarafından fiziksel bir adres.

Adres bağlama neden gereklidir?

NS bağlayıcı gerekli mantıksal belleği fiziksel belleğe bağlamak. Programın nerede saklandığını bilmek gerekli erişmek için. bağlayıcı üç farklı tipte olabilir. Derleme zamanı bağlama : Adres programın nerede depolandığı derleme zamanında bilinir.

Önerilen: